Chief Justice Earl Warren delivered the opinion of the unanimous Court. The Supreme Court held that “separate but equal” amenities are inherently unequal and violate the protections of the Equal Protection Clause of the Fourteenth Amendment.Board of Education case of 1954 legally ended a long time of racial segregation in America’s public faculties. Chief Justice Earl Warren delivered the unanimous ruling within the landmark civil rights case. State-sanctioned segregation of public faculties was a violation of the 14th Amendment and was due to this fact unconstitutional.The ruling of the case “Brown vs the Board of Education” is, that racial segregation is unconstitutional in public faculties. This additionally proves that it violated the 14th modification to the structure, which prohibits the states from denying equal rights to any particular person.

What did the Brown II resolution say quizlet?

What did the Brown II resolution say? Schools needs to be desegregated “with all deliberate speed.”

Why was the ruling in Brown v. Board of Education so essential?

The Topeka Brown case is essential as a result of it helped persuade the Court that even when bodily amenities and different “tangible” components have been equal, segregation nonetheless disadvantaged minority kids of equal instructional alternatives.

What occurred after Brown v. Board of Education?

Passage of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, backed by enforcement by the Justice Department, started the method of desegregation in earnest. This landmark piece of civil rights laws was adopted by the Voting Rights Act of 1965 and the Fair Housing Act of 1968.

What does Chief Justice Warren declare about why the doctrine of separate however equal created inferiority?

The courtroom burdened that the badge of inferiority stamped on minority kids by segregation hindered their full growth regardless of how equal the amenities. “We conclude that in the field of public education the doctrine of ‘separate but equal’ has no place,” wrote Chief Justice Earl Warren.

What have been the 2 main accomplishment of the Supreme Court underneath Chief Justice Warren quizlet?

the US Supreme courtroom underneath chief Justice Earl Warren, determined such landmarks instances as Brown v. Board of schooling (faculty desegregation) Baker v Carr (legislative redistricting) and Gideon vs. Wainwright and Miranda vs. Arizona (rights of prison defendants.
